New EV Rules Mean Fewer Models Eligible for Tax Credit

The Biden administration is proposing strict rules for the $7500 tax credit on new EV vehicles. Rules going into effect April 18 will restrict the credit only to certain models yet to be announced that fulfill strict criteria on sourcing of minerals in the US or friendly countries. The idea is to bring the supply chain for minerals critical for EV batteries back to the US and its partners, and shift it away from China that today controls that supply chain.
